A major insight into human behavior from preinternet era studies of communication is the tendency of people not to speak up about policy issues in publicor among their family, friends, and work colleagueswhen they believe their own point of view is not widely shared. Specifically, the perception that ones opinion is unpopular tends to inhibit or discourage ones expression of it. Originally proposed by german political scientist elisabeth noelleneumann in 1974, spiral of silence is the term meant to refer to the tendence of people to remain silent when they feel that their views are in opposition to the majority view on a subject.

The spiral of silence attempts to explain how media consumption, interaction among key groups, and opinion expression all interact to form opinions in society.
